WebTag Archives: Summercrisp Lettuce Post navigation Grow Luscious Lettuce (Lactuca sativa) Posted on September 24, 2014 by Jay White. 1. ... is generally broken up into seven categories based on leaf structure and use. These categories are leaf, romaine, crisphead, butterhead, summercrisp, stem and oilseed. WebSep 19, 2024 · Batavia lettuce is a summer crisp variety that will germinate in warm temperatures and is slow to bolt. There are both open and close headed varieties in colors of green, burgundy, red, magenta, and mixed hues. All kinds of Batavia lettuce are open pollinated and good options for a late season garden.
